Course goals: This is a continuation of Numerical Computing, but including topics in sophomore-level mathematics and with more emphasis on theoretical results. Some topics will be revisited in more depth, and we will do numerical linear algebra( matrix computations, determinants, solving linear systems, eigenvalues, eigenvectors), multi-variable interpolation, multivariable root-finding and maximum and minimum, multivariable numerical integration, and differential equations.
